Carmarthenshire County Council wishes to commission a Provider to provide Training for Safeguarding Group B & Group C.
The training sessions will need to be delivered in-person, during evenings and weekends to accommodate the Early Years and Childcare Settings.
All safeguarding training must be delivered by trainers who meet the competency requirements set out in the ‘Wales Safeguarding Procedures’ and the ‘Social Care Wales’ framework for safeguarding learning.
